ubuntu 下安装jdk
来源:互联网 发布:人工智能类电影 编辑:程序博客网 时间:2024/06/17 00:04
ubuntu 下安装jdk
1、在官网上下载JDK(选择相应的 .gz包下载 )
http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html
由于在官网上下载比较慢,如果远程服务器上有,也可以在远程服务器上下载已经下载好的JDK
命令如下
sudo scp 账号@远程地址:/home/jdk-8u101-linux-x64.tar.gz /home/mdl/xk然后输入远程地址的账号的密码,即可下载
2、创建目录
sudo mkdir /usr/lib/jvm
3、将jdk文件解压缩
sudo tar -zxvf jdk-7u60-linux-x64.gz -C /usr/lib/jvm
4、修改环境变量
$sudo gedit ~/.bashrc 或者sudo vi ~/.bashrc
5、文件的末尾追加下面内容
#set oracle jdk environmentexport JAVA_HOME=/usr/lib/jvm/jdk1.7.0_60 ## 这里要注意目录要换成自己解压的jdk 目录export JRE_HOME=${JAVA_HOME}/jre export CLASSPATH=.:${JAVA_HOME}/lib:${JRE_HOME}/lib export PATH=${JAVA_HOME}/bin:$PATH
6、使环境变量马上生效
source ~/.bashrc
7、设置系统默认jdk 版本
sudo update-alternatives --install /usr/bin/java java /usr/lib/jvm/jdk1.7.0_60/bin/java 300 sudo update-alternatives --install /usr/bin/javac javac /usr/lib/jvm/jdk1.7.0_60/bin/javac 300 sudo update-alternatives --install /usr/bin/jar jar /usr/lib/jvm/jdk1.7.0_60/bin/jar 300 sudo update-alternatives --install /usr/bin/javah javah /usr/lib/jvm/jdk1.7.0_60/bin/javah 300 sudo update-alternatives --install /usr/bin/javap javap /usr/lib/jvm/jdk1.7.0_60/bin/javap 300
然后执行:
sudo update-alternatives --config java
若是初次安装jdk,会有下面的提示
There is only one alternative in link group java (providing /usr/bin/java): /usr/lib/jvm/jdk1.7.0_60/bin/java
否则,选择合适的jdk
8、测试jdk
java -versionjava version "1.7.0_60" Java(TM) SE Runtime Environment (build 1.7.0_60-b19) Java HotSpot(TM) 64-Bit Server VM (build 24.60-b09, mixed mode)
参考http://www.cnblogs.com/a2211009/p/4265225.html
阅读全文
0 0
- ubuntu下安装jdk
- ubuntu下安装jdk
- ubuntu下安装JDK
- ubuntu 下JDK安装
- Ubuntu 下安装 jdk
- Ubuntu下安装JDK.
- Ubuntu下安装JDK
- Ubuntu 下安装JDK
- Ubuntu下安装JDK
- ubuntu下安装jdk
- Ubuntu下安装JDK
- Ubuntu 下安装JDK
- ubuntu下安装jdk
- ubuntu 下安装jdk
- Ubuntu下安装JDK
- ubuntu 下安装jdk
- ubuntu下安装JDK
- Ubuntu下安装jdk
- JS 压缩混淆
- 脉冲云是如何实现应用相互访问的
- Android Studio Live Templates使用详解,提高敲代码的速度
- 第四章整合管理
- 使用两个栈实现一个队列
- ubuntu 下安装jdk
- Python013列表生成
- 【Vuforia】Vuforia实现自动对焦的代码
- 简单排序——直接插入排序
- LINUX下如何创建TCP客户端和服务器,实现通信
- const修饰变量的总结
- windows下编译openssl
- Redux简介
- C++学习笔记——继承与派生